package com.oracle.truffle.object.basic.test;
import org.junit.Assert;
import com.oracle.truffle.api.object.DynamicObject;
import com.oracle.truffle.api.object.Location;
import com.oracle.truffle.api.object.Shape;
import com.oracle.truffle.object.LocationImpl;
import com.oracle.truffle.object.ShapeImpl;
import com.oracle.truffle.object.basic.BasicLocations.FieldLocation;
import com.oracle.truffle.object.basic.BasicLocations.PrimitiveLocationDecorator;
import com.oracle.truffle.object.basic.BasicLocations.SimpleLongFieldLocation;
import com.oracle.truffle.object.basic.BasicLocations.SimpleObjectFieldLocation;
public abstract class DOTestAsserts {
public static void assertLocationFields(Location location, int prims, int objects) {
LocationImpl locationImpl = (LocationImpl) location;
Assert.assertEquals(prims, locationImpl.primitiveFieldCount());
Assert.assertEquals(objects, locationImpl.objectFieldCount());
}
public static void assertShapeFields(DynamicObject object, int prims, int objects) {
ShapeImpl shape = (ShapeImpl) object.getShape();
Assert.assertEquals(objects, shape.getObjectFieldSize());
Assert.assertEquals(prims, shape.getPrimitiveFieldSize());
Assert.assertEquals(0, shape.getObjectArraySize());
Assert.assertEquals(0, shape.getPrimitiveArraySize());
}
public static void assertSameLocation(Location location1, Location location2) {
Assert.assertSame(getInternalLocation(location1), getInternalLocation(location2));
}
public static void assertNotSameLocation(Location location1, Location location2) {
Assert.assertNotSame(getInternalLocation(location1), getInternalLocation(location2));
}
private static FieldLocation getInternalLocation(Location location) {
if (location instanceof PrimitiveLocationDecorator) {
return (FieldLocation) ((PrimitiveLocationDecorator) location).getInternalLocation();
} else if (location instanceof SimpleLongFieldLocation) {
return (FieldLocation) location;
} else if (location instanceof SimpleObjectFieldLocation) {
return (FieldLocation) location;
} else {
throw new AssertionError("Could not find internal location of " + location);
}
}
public static void assertShape(String fields, Shape shape) {
Assert.assertEquals(shapeId(shape) + fields, shape.toString());
}
private static String shapeId(Shape shape) {
return "@" + Integer.toHexString(shape.hashCode());
}
}
